What is it?
Stem cell therapy uses cells obtained from the patient’s own body, usually from a small sample of fat. These cells have the ability to help repair damaged tissues, reduce inflammation and improve joint function. It is a regenerative medicine treatment, designed to stimulate the natural recovery processes without the need for surgery.
What problems is it used for?
It is mainly used in problems of the musculoskeletal system, such as:
- Knee, hip and shoulder arthrosis
- Tendon and ligament injuries
- Sports injuries
- Chronic joint pain
The objective is to relieve pain, improve mobility and promote functional recovery.
How does it help?
Stem cells act by reducing inflammation and stimulating the repair of damaged tissues, such as cartilage. This can translate into less pain, greater flexibility and a better quality of life. In many cases, it can delay or avoid surgery.
How are they obtained?
A simple and minimally invasive procedure is performed to obtain a small amount of adipose tissue (fat). The process is safe and is performed in a controlled clinical environment.
How is the treatment applied?
The cells are placed by direct injection into the affected area (such as a joint or tendon). It is an outpatient procedure, well tolerated and with rapid recovery, allowing the patient to resume normal activities following medical indications.
